For every $1 billion GM makes in North America, the automaker's hourly U.S. employees receive $1,000, according to the Detroit automaker's agreement with the United Auto Workers. GM made about $14.258 ...
GM hourly employees who worked 1,850 compensated hours are expected to receive a profit-sharing check of $14,500.
